Susheel Praneeth is a researcher focused on the intersection of robotics and reinforcement learning, with a particular emphasis on model-free control strategies for autonomous systems. His most notable contribution is a pioneering work on a universal trajectory tracking controller for mobile robots, which leverages online reinforcement learning to enable adaptive, real-time navigation without requiring a pre-defined system model. This approach addresses a critical challenge in robotics—ensuring robust performance in dynamic, unstructured environments where traditional model-based controllers often fail.
